Utilizing the Ouija board a friend has loaned her, Cammi Fanelli becomes panic-stricken from the mysterious messages received by a spirit calling himself, “Malcolm.” She bewails her decision to play with the game, due to curiosity, knowing that something sinister has entered her life. She tells no one about the incident. Benjamin Treadwell, living almost a century before Cammi, struggles to build an empire for his family while teaching his son Benny to love their land. Always an optimist, Benny is blind to the fact that his father has chosen to build his house on the entrance to the gates of Hell. Later he realizes, through horrific losses associated with their home, that evil forces permeate his family’s property. Sleeping demons awake with a vengeance to lead Cammi, her husband Michael and daughters Jenna and Renee on a journey that will forever change their lives. When Cammi and Michael decide to move from Long Island into the Adirondack Mountains, they are unprepared for the harsh climate changes and the demonic forces that await them. Their journey ends inside the old Treadwell homestead, where normal events mutate into paranormal experiences with devastating results.
